National Park Cerro Verde, El Salvador
National Park Cerro Verde, located in El Salvador, is a captivating natural reserve known for its lush cloud forests and stunning volcanic landscapes. At an elevation of approximately 2,030 meters, the park offers panoramic views of three prominent volcanoes: Izalco, Santa Ana, and Cerro Verde itself. The park is home to diverse flora and fauna, making it a haven for nature lovers and bird watchers. Visitors can explore well-maintained trails, enjoy the cool climate, and immerse themselves in the tranquility of this unique ecological area.

Best Time to Visit National Park Cerro Verde
The best time to visit National Park Cerro Verde is during the dry season, from November to April. During these months, the weather is more predictable, with less rain and clearer skies, offering better visibility for scenic views and outdoor activities.
